Welcoming Community for Newcomers to Scarborough
Objective
Support service providers, faith-based groups, stakeholders and the community in working together to make Scarborough a welcoming place where newcomers feel connected, supported, develop a sense of belonging and actively participate in community and civic life.
Desired outcomes
- Organizations and communities in Scarborough are working together to create an environment that helps newcomers to get to know the neighbourhood where they settle, meet others and participate in civic and community activities, leading to stronger participation, greater inclusion and more connected communities.
